Bending Glass And Other Wonders

Corning Inc, the inventors of low-loss optical fiber wire in the 1970s, have devised a way to use nanostructures to allow fiber-optic cable to be bent around tight corners without loss of signal. This opens up the way for high speed fiber service to be made available to millions of customers in such places as apartment buildings and condominiums where incoming lines must be snaked through all sorts of walls to deliver service.
